World Down Syndrome Day takes place on 21 March every year. This date (3.21) represents the 3 copies of chromosome 21, which is unique to people with Down syndrome.
The goals of World Down Syndrome Day are to promote awareness and understanding, seek international support, and to achieve dignity, equal rights and a better life for people with Down syndrome everywhere.
Activities and events held on World Down Syndrome Day can have a tremendous impact, showcasing the abilities, talents and accomplishments of people with Down syndrome.
